ALSA can only use default - Not hw:0,0 hw1,0 etc.

I have Debian Etch on an ASUS P5B system with an onboard sound-card (hda-intel) and a Terratec Phase 22 card in a PCI slot (ice1724).
I have added the following lines to /etc/modprobe.d/sound :
alias snd-card-0 snd-ice1724
options snd-ice1724 index=0
alias snd-card-1 snd-hda-intel
options snd-hda-intel index=1
..consequently the Phase 22 (ice1724) is the default card.

My problem is that 'default' is the only card I can use with ALSA. A command like 'aplay -D hw:0,0 test.wav' results in an error. I cannot direct sound from any program to a card of my choice. When I set up MPD to use hw:0,0 or hw:1,0 the program does not play any music at all.

Here is the output of some commands:

# asoundconf list 
Names of available sound cards: 
 (no cards are listed)

# aplay -D hw:0,0 test.wav
Playing WAVE 'test.wav' : Signed 16 bit Little Endian, Rate 11025 Hz, Mono
aplay: set_params:904: Sample format non available
 ('aplay test.wav' works fine)

# aplay -l
**** List of PLAYBACK Hardware Devices ****
card 0: T22 [Terratec PHASE 22], device 0: ICE1724 [ICE1724]
  Subdevices: 1/1
  Subdevice #0: subdevice #0
card 0: T22 [Terratec PHASE 22], device 1: IEC1724 IEC958 [IEC1724 IEC958]
  Subdevices: 1/1
  Subdevice #0: subdevice #0
card 1: Intel [HDA Intel], device 0: AD198x Analog [AD198x Analog]
  Subdevices: 1/1
  Subdevice #0: subdevice #0
card 1: Intel [HDA Intel], device 1: AD198x Digital [AD198x Digital]
  Subdevices: 1/1
  Subdevice #0: subdevice #0

# cat /proc/asound/modules
 0 snd_ice1724
 1 snd_hda_intel

I tried using aliases in .asoundrc

pcm.TP22 	{ 
		type  hw  
		card 0
		device 0 
		}
pcm.Intel 	{ 
		type  hw  
		card 1 
		device 0
		}

..but using, for instance 'aplay -D TP22 test.wav' gives the same error as shown above.


There must be something wrong with my setup - and the result is that I cannot use the non-default card without changing a configuration file and restarting ALSA. I hope one of you can help me out.
